Hey All,

 

Well i have the micro break and rest break configured.

 

Micro: 1m15s break every 6m15s

Rest: 6m15 every 25m

 

At work I have the skip button enabled ( I do not use the postpone ) because
when I'm on the phone with a customer I need to be able to do stuff.

At home I have it disabled ( which can be frustrating at some times, but it
does keep me in check )

 

I've came to these numbers after 2 years of usage, the breaks are not too
long and the periods are not too close to each other to annoy me.

Hi Ilian,

If workrave interrupts you once every hour, you should consider yourself
very lucky. For me, it interrupts me once every 2.5 minutes :-) And yes,
I use it all the time (though I sometimes choose to ignore it :-)

I think it is important to somehow have the feeling that you, yourself
are in control, instead of workrave. If you feel like being trapped by a
tool telling you things, you're probably not going to be very happy
about it.

Instead of feeling like workrave is telling you to do things, you could
also consider workrave's intrusions as friendly advice or well-meant
recommendations. After all, you, yourself have asked workrave to
interrupt you, presumably because it is for your own good.

If you find it hard to delude (for lack of a better term) yourself this
way, you could change workraves settings to be less restrictive: show
skip/postpone buttons and/or don't block you from continuing to work
when workrave prompts you to break. That should help relieve the feeling
of being trapped a little.
